Founded in 1869, The People's Friend is a long-standing British publication primarily recognized for its extensive collection of wholesome fiction, including short stories, serials, and poetry across genres such as romance, cozy crime, and historical drama. Often described as the world's longest-running weekly women’s magazine, it maintains a focus on traditional values and community, featuring regular sections on knitting and craft projects, gardening advice, seasonal recipes, and health and wellbeing tips. The magazine is also well-known for its distinctive cover art, which typically depicts picturesque landscapes, towns, and villages from across the United Kingdom, often tying into internal travel features and nostalgia-driven articles about British heritage and local history.
